DOR PROJECT

 

​​The DOR Project (“DOR”) located in the Xieng Khouang Province, approximately 400 km NE from Vientiane, the capital of Lao PDR

 

The BMX concession covers an area of 5 km2 and hosts iron-copper-gold scarn mineralisation.  The nearest significant defined resource is Phu Bia Mining Limited's KTL Copper-Gold deposit, located 30 km southwest of the DOR Site.

 

The DOR Project consists of three open pits: DOR South, DOR North, and DOR West. The deposits are near surface and well suited for extraction by conventional open pit methods.
 

Following a 15-year exploration campaign a JORC compliant resource was estimated on the 5 km2 concession area.

 

The project will be developed in 2 stages. An oxide stage (open pit down to 30 m from surface) with an 8-year mine life and sulphide stage (open pit from 30 m to 80 m) with a 4-year mine life (but further drilling can increase the resource and extend the mine life).
 

The resource at the DOR Project is currently estimated at 6.13 Mt consisting of 34,000 T of copper at 0.55%, 90,000 Oz of gold at 0.45 g/t, 2.1 Moz of silver at 11 g/t and 801,000 T of iron ore at 13%.
 

The project is estimated to deliver a US$654M net profit (before taxes and capex).
 

Phase 1 of the Oxide Stage is the DOR South Pit Mine and is estimated to produce a net profit of US$217M (before taxes and capex).
